Auto Repair in Windham, New Hampshire
View Map
4
Landry and Noyles Automotive +Motorcycle Service LLC
120 Lowell Rd, Windham Nh 03087 (603) 898-9239Auto Repair in Other Cities
- Auto Repair in Albany, New Hampshire
- Auto Repair in Alexandria, New Hampshire
- Auto Repair in Allenstown, New Hampshire
- Auto Repair in Alstead, New Hampshire
- Auto Repair in Alton, New Hampshire
- Auto Repair in Amherst, New Hampshire
- Auto Repair in Andover, New Hampshire
- Auto Repair in Antrim, New Hampshire
- Auto Repair in Ashland, New Hampshire
- Auto Repair in Atkinson, New Hampshire